ADT7461ARZ-REEL7 Information
ADT7461ARZ-REEL7 by Analog Devices Inc is a Temperature Sensor.
Temperature Sensors are under the broader part category of Sensors/Transducers.
Sensors and transducers detect and measure physical quantities like temperature, pressure, and force, converting them into electrical signals for various applications. Read more about Sensors/Transducers on our Sensors/Transducers part category page.

IC SPECIALTY ANALOG CIRCUIT, PDSO8, LEAD FREE, MS-012-AA, SOIC-8, Analog IC:Other
|
Pbfree Code | Yes | |
Rohs Code | Yes | |
Part Life Cycle Code | Transferred | |
Ihs Manufacturer | ANALOG DEVICES INC | |
Part Package Code | SOIC | |
Package Description | SOIC-8 | |
Pin Count | 8 | |
Reach Compliance Code | compliant | |
HTS Code | 8542.39.00.01 | |
Accuracy-Max (Cel) | 3 Cel | |
Body Breadth | 3.9 mm | |
Body Height | 1.75 mm | |
Body Length or Diameter | 4.9 mm | |
JESD-609 Code | e3 | |
Mounting Feature | SURFACE MOUNT | |
Number of Bits | 8 | |
Number of Terminals | 8 | |
Operating Current-Max | 0.215 mA | |
Operating Temperature-Max | 125 °C | |
Operating Temperature-Min | -40 °C | |
Output Interface Type | 2-WIRE INTERFACE | |
Package Body Material | PLASTIC/EPOXY | |
Package Equivalence Code | SOP8,.25 | |
Package Shape/Style | RECTANGULAR | |
Sensors/Transducers Type | TEMPERATURE SENSOR,SWITCH/DIGITAL OUTPUT,SERIAL | |
Supply Voltage-Max | 5.5 V | |
Supply Voltage-Min | 3 V | |
Surface Mount | YES | |
Temperature Coefficient | NEGATIVE ppm/°C | |
Terminal Finish | Matte Tin (Sn) - annealed | |
Termination Type | SOLDER |
